FELA is a federal law

The Federal Employers' Liability Act (FELA) protects railroad employees who suffer injuries on the job. It is the only remedy available to railroad workers who suffer injuries during the course of their job. Injured employees can recover damages from their employers in a civil court. Workers who have been injured could also be entitled to compensation for medical expenses, lost wages and discomfort and pain.

It is a system that doesn't any person accountable

If a railroad employee gets injured while at work, they are able to sue their employer under the Federal Employers' employers’ liability act fela Act. While FELA and workers' compensation are alike in that both allow workers to file a claim, and receive financial compensation for their injuries, there are a few differences between the two systems. The primary difference between FELA and workers compensation is that FELA requires the worker to be able to prove negligence on behalf their employer in order to receive compensation. This makes the claims process more complex than a traditional workers' compensation system.

In a FELA lawsuit, the railroad is liable to pay medical expenses as well as lost earnings in the past and the future and also for discomfort and pain. A FELA case also permits workers to recover damages due to aggravated existing conditions or a diminished standard of life. A FELA lawsuit unlike a workers compensation case, is decided by a peer jury, and the plaintiff doesn't have to accept any settlement offer from the railroad.

Moreover, FELA removes the railroad's defenses of taking on the risk of employment as well as contributory negligence. Despite this the law provides a statute of limitations of three years from the date of injury. Proof of negligence is required

If a railroad worker is injured on the job they have to prove that the injury was caused by the negligence of their employer. This is much like a workers compensation claim, however there are differences in how the case is handled. A fela claims lawyer who is knowledgeable can assist you in understanding the differences and defend your rights.

To receive full compensation for injuries, a railroad employee must be able show that the railroad was negligent. This is typically done by proving that the railroad did not provide an environment for work that was safe, failed to inspect equipment or provide adequate training. The injury must also be proved to be caused not through the negligence of an employee or a defective item, but by the railroad.
